§ 11-33-7. Perjury or false swearing — Child support.
Every person who shall violate any provision of this chapter in any case or controversy involving the abandonment or nonsupport of a child pending before the family court or any other tribunal or agency of competent jurisdiction shall be guilty of a felony and shall be imprisoned for a term not to exceed twenty (20) years.
[See § 12-1-15 of the General Laws.]
History of Section.P.L. 1995, ch. 370, art. 29, § 3; P.L. 1995, ch. 374, § 3.
